Buying an aftermarket radiator, such as the (89GRJX46) for a 2010-2011 Kia Soul, comes with both advantages and disadvantages. Here's a detailed analysis:
Advantages:1. Cost-effective: Aftermarket radiators are generally more affordable than their O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) counterparts. This can save you significant money, especially if you need to replace the radiator frequently due to the car's cooling system issues.
2. Enhanced performance: Aftermarket radiators are often designed to provide better cooling efficiency and durability than OEM radiators. This can help improve your car's overall performance and longevity.
3. Wide availability: Aftermarket radiators are produced by various manufacturers and are readily available at auto parts stores and online retailers. This makes it easier for you to find the right radiator for your specific car model and year.
4. Customization: Aftermarket radiators offer more options in terms of design, material, and size. This can allow you to customize the radiator to better suit your car's specific cooling needs.
Disadvantages:1. Quality concerns: The quality of aftermarket radiators can vary greatly depending on the manufacturer. Some aftermarket radiators may not meet the same standards as OEM radiators in terms of materials, manufacturing processes, or durability.
2. Fit and compatibility issues: While aftermarket radiators are designed to fit most cars, there is still a risk of fit and compatibility issues. These issues can lead to leaks, coolant loss, or other problems that may require additional time and money to fix.
3. Lack of warranty: Many aftermarket radiators do not come with the same level of warranty coverage as OEM radiators. This can leave you without recourse if the radiator fails prematurely or does not meet your expectations.
Conclusion:When considering the purchase of an aftermarket radiator (89GRJX46) for your 2010-2011 Kia Soul, it's essential to weigh the advantages and disadvantages carefully. The cost savings, enhanced performance, and wide availability of aftermarket radiators can be significant, but the potential quality concerns, fit and compatibility issues, and lack of warranty may outweigh the benefits for some car owners. It's recommended that you research potential aftermarket radiator manufacturers carefully, read customer reviews, and consult with a trusted mechanic or auto parts expert to ensure that you're making the best decision for your car. Ultimately, if you're confident in the quality and compatibility of the aftermarket radiator, it can be a cost-effective and efficient solution for your cooling needs.
